workaround for gt flowing oils

This commit is contained in:
Pyritie
2026-02-21 00:57:18 +00:00
parent f61be803ee
commit fa4cb84be8
5 changed files with 48 additions and 0 deletions

View File

@@ -0,0 +1,6 @@
{
"fluid": "gtceu:flowing_oil_heavy",
"burnTime": 50,
"superHeat": false,
"amountConsumedPerTick" : 5
}

View File

@@ -0,0 +1,6 @@
{
"fluid": "gtceu:flowing_oil_light",
"burnTime": 50,
"superHeat": false,
"amountConsumedPerTick" : 32
}

View File

@@ -0,0 +1,6 @@
{
"fluid": "gtceu:flowing_oil",
"burnTime": 50,
"superHeat": false,
"amountConsumedPerTick" : 32
}

View File

@@ -0,0 +1,6 @@
{
"fluid": "gtceu:flowing_oil_medium",
"burnTime": 50,
"superHeat": false,
"amountConsumedPerTick" : 32
}

View File

@@ -70,12 +70,24 @@ function registerTFGPowerGenBalance(event) {
.heated()
.id('tfg:vi/vacuumizing/light_fuel_from_oil')
event.recipes.vintageimprovements.vacuumizing(Fluid.of('gtceu:light_fuel', 250), [Fluid.of('gtceu:flowing_oil', 1000)])
.secondaryFluidOutput(0)
.processingTime(500)
.heated()
.id('tfg:vi/vacuumizing/light_fuel_from_flowing_oil')
event.recipes.vintageimprovements.vacuumizing(Fluid.of('gtceu:light_fuel', 50), [Fluid.of('gtceu:oil_light', 1000)])
.secondaryFluidOutput(0)
.processingTime(500)
.heated()
.id('tfg:vi/vacuumizing/light_fuel_from_light_oil')
event.recipes.vintageimprovements.vacuumizing(Fluid.of('gtceu:light_fuel', 50), [Fluid.of('gtceu:flowing_oil_light', 1000)])
.secondaryFluidOutput(0)
.processingTime(500)
.heated()
.id('tfg:vi/vacuumizing/light_fuel_from_flowing_light_oil')
// Raw Oil to Naphtha
event.recipes.vintageimprovements.vacuumizing(Fluid.of('gtceu:naphtha', 500), [Fluid.of('gtceu:oil_medium', 1000)])
@@ -84,6 +96,12 @@ function registerTFGPowerGenBalance(event) {
.heated()
.id('tfg:vi/vacuumizing/light_fuel_from_raw_oil')
event.recipes.vintageimprovements.vacuumizing(Fluid.of('gtceu:naphtha', 500), [Fluid.of('gtceu:flowing_oil_medium', 1000)])
.secondaryFluidOutput(0)
.processingTime(500)
.heated()
.id('tfg:vi/vacuumizing/light_fuel_from_flowing_raw_oil')
// Heavy oil to Heavy Fuel
event.recipes.vintageimprovements.vacuumizing(Fluid.of('gtceu:heavy_fuel', 750), [Fluid.of('gtceu:oil_heavy', 1000)])
@@ -92,6 +110,12 @@ function registerTFGPowerGenBalance(event) {
.heated()
.id('tfg:vi/vacuumizing/heavy_fuel_from_heavy_oil')
event.recipes.vintageimprovements.vacuumizing(Fluid.of('gtceu:heavy_fuel', 750), [Fluid.of('gtceu:flowing_oil_heavy', 1000)])
.secondaryFluidOutput(0)
.processingTime(500)
.heated()
.id('tfg:vi/vacuumizing/heavy_fuel_from_flowing_heavy_oil')
// Switch HOG to require IV Energy Hatch
event.remove({ id: 'gtceu:large_chemical_reactor/high_octane_gasoline' })